It seems like everywhere you look, someone is mad at Facebook. The company has been embroiled in one controversy after another, with users and lawmakers alike accusing it of violating people’s privacy, not doing enough to stop election interference, and exploiting its users for profit.
So why is everyone mad at Facebook?
There are a number of reasons. To start, Facebook has a history of mishandling users’ data. In March 2018, it was revealed that the data of up to 87 million Facebook users had been improperly accessed by the political consultancy firm Cambridge Analytica. Facebook had known about the issue since 2015 but failed to inform users.
Facebook has also been criticized for its role in spreading misinformation and propaganda. During the 2016 U.S. presidential election, Russian trolls used Facebook to spread fake news and sow discord among American voters. Facebook has since pledged to do more to prevent election interference, but many people remain skeptical.
Facebook has also been accused of exploiting its users for profit. The company has come under fire for its use of “like” and “share” buttons, which allow Facebook to track users’ web browsing habits even when they’re not using Facebook. Facebook has also been criticized for its “Sponsored Stories” feature, which allows companies to pay to have their posts promoted to users’ friends.

What are the problems with Facebook?
There are a number of problems with Facebook, many of which have to do with privacy. For example, the site has a history of changing its privacy settings without warning users, and of sharing users’ personal data with third-party companies.
Facebook has also been criticized for its addictive nature. The site has been designed in a way that deliberately encourages users to check in frequently, share updates and photos, and stay connected with friends. This can be problematic for people who find themselves spending too much time on the site and who start to neglect other aspects of their lives.
Facebook has also been criticized for its role in spreading fake news. The site has been accused of not doing enough to stop the spread of false information, and of not taking enough responsibility for the content that is shared on its platform.
Finally, Facebook has been criticized for its impact on mental health. The site can be addictive and can cause people to feel negative emotions such as envy and loneliness.

What is the alternative to Facebook?
There are a few different alternatives to Facebook that you can use. Each of these services has its own unique features and benefits.
One alternative is Mastodon. Mastodon is a decentralized social media platform that is based on the open-source software GNU social. It allows you to create posts, follow other users, and join or create communities. Mastodon is unique in that it is not controlled by a single company or individual. Instead, it is managed by a decentralized network of servers.
Another alternative to Facebook is Diaspora. Diaspora is a social networking platform that is based on the principles of decentralization and privacy. It allows you to create a profile, share photos and videos, and follow other users. Diaspora is unique in that it does not store your data on a central server. Instead, it distributes it among a network of servers. This helps to ensure that your data is not subject to surveillance by companies or governments.
Finally, you can also use Gab. Gab is a social media platform that is designed for conservatives and libertarians. It allows you to create a profile, follow other users, and share photos and videos. Gab is unique in that it does not censor user content. This makes it a popular choice for people who want to express their views freely.
